Rating standards: show
1 star: (0 - 5.75 in LDC) These levels need a lot of work. They're totally un-elaborated, and/or inherently flawed due to things like cutoff or enemy spam, or they're untested and there are too many bugs gameplay-wise, in short: Many many things went wrong in such a level.

2 stars: (6 - 9.75) These levels are not terrible, but poor. They're too short, lack scenery or they have errors and/or bugs but it's still barely enjoyable. Again, spend more effort and try to do better. (if it's your first level that I rate two stars, it's not bad. There's a long way you can still go)

3 stars: (10 - 12.75) These levels are about mediocre. They may be still a little bit short, the gameplay is fine but not very original and graphics are also solid, but not breath-taking. Try to keep improving!

4 stars: (13 - 15) These levels are nice, but not the best. Effort has been put into them, there can some professionality be seen in gameplay and graphics, they're a nice experience to play, but there are still things you can do to make it even better. Try to go the extra mile!

5 stars: (15.25 - 20) These are really great levels, those which, as said, I would give more than 15 in an LDC. These suffice many high requirements, and it already goes into subtleties if you want to make them better. These levels are successful all around. Bravo.

These are just general principles I try to follow when rating. Sometimes I don't leave a further comment when rating, most times I do, if you have questions about it, feel free to ask further.

Postby ~MP3 Amplifier~ » May 6th, 2015, 2:46 pm

Supershroom wrote:I don't think any of our reliable judges would go like "oh, this level will be a strong contender for me, let's look for -0.25's I can dock off".


This is one of the main things, really. People's opinions on the judgings they receive heavily depend on if you trust the judges or not. Personally, I think if someone has been given permission to judge, people need to put their faith in them otherwise it's only inevitable that conflict will break out at some point.




I've entered a lot of LDCs and in nearly every LDC I can remember, there was always one score that I really didn't like and wished could be higher.
This is perfectly natural and it's not the judges' fault, they were just doing their job. If it's a really unfair point reduction, then fair enough, if we go through with these meetings, hopefully we can knock out any of those before releasing the results. But if it's down to pure opinion then I think anything has a right to stay the same if that's how the player feels about that level.
